Understand Your Printing Needs

What Are You Printing?

Knowing the material of your phone case is crucial. Phone cases come in many types such as plastic, TPU, tempered glass, or even wood. Some printers are designed for plastics, while others efficiently handle materials like wood and tempered glass. If you are aiming for 3D sublimation effects or a UV varnish finish, the printer must have the capability to process these specialised effects.

Volume of Production

Deciding whether you need a printer for low-volume, personalised phone case printing or for high-volume commercial production is critical. Your operational needs must guide your choice, balancing factors such as speed, maintenance, and output quality.

Types of Printers for Phone Cases

UV Printers

UV printers have become popular for printing on phone cases due to their ability to produce quick-drying and vibrant colours. These printers work well with a variety of materials and offer the depth of detail needed for intricate designs, especially when handling diverse demands.

3D Sublimation Printers

3D sublimation printers can be a great option if you need to create detailed, personalised designs on your cases. These printers shine when it comes to crafting complex and colourful imagery, though it is important to understand their limitations depending on the volume you plan to produce.

Inkjet Printers

Inkjet printers designed for direct-to-object printing are another option for those interested in custom phone case design. Heat-Press Machines

For those exploring sublimation printing, heat-press machines offer an alternative method. While they work well for many designs, there may be trade-offs in terms of setup time and versatility. Weigh the pros and cons based on your specific production needs.

Key Features to Look for in a Phone Case Printer

Printing Quality

When customising phone cases, the sharpness and vibrancy of your design matter. High resolution—often measured in DPI—is crucial to ensure every detail of your artwork is clearly reproduced.

Material Compatibility

Some printers offer the flexibility to work with various materials. A printer that can handle plastics as well as less common surfaces like wood or tempered glass will give you greater creative freedom.

Ease of Use

Look for user-friendly printers with intuitive software and automated processes. A well-designed interface simplifies the printing process and reduces the learning curve, especially when experimenting with new designs.

Durability and Maintenance

For long-term projects or high-volume production, durability is key. A printer that is robust and easy to maintain will result in fewer interruptions and lower overall service costs, ensuring a smooth workflow over time.

Advanced Printing Technologies

UV Printing Technology for Phone Cases

UV printing is a standout method for phone case printing. Its ability to produce high-quality, durable designs quickly makes it a preferred choice. With instant drying and a reduction in environmental impact from solvents, this technology has set a benchmark in the consumer electronics printing sphere.

Direct-to-Object Printing

Direct-to-object printing takes customisation a step further by offering precision that traditional methods might not match. This technique ensures that every design element is captured accurately, giving you the confidence that your phone case design will meet high standards.

Frequently Asked Questions

What printer do you need to make phone cases?

UV printers are commonly chosen for phone case printing because of their high-quality output and compatibility with various materials. Alternatives such as 3D sublimation printers and direct-to-object inkjet printers are also popular.

How are phone cases printed?

Printing methods for phone cases include UV printing, sublimation, and direct-to-object inkjet printing. Each method produces sharp, durable, and customisable designs.

Can you get a printer for a mobile phone?

Yes, there are compact printers specifically designed for mobile phone cases, including UV and sublimation machines.

Can a 3D printer make phone cases?

3D printers can create the physical framework of phone cases and, in some instances, facilitate printing designs directly onto them, though they are primarily used for case creation.
